Deuba faction unhappy over nominations

KATHMANDU, March 21: The Deuba-faction of the Nepali Congress has expressed dissatisfaction over the recent nominations in the party´s student wing -- Nepal Students´ Union -- and has asked the party establishment to rectify the nominations.



Taking strong exception to the formation of a 101-member committee of Nepal Students´ Union, Nepali Congress central committee member Surendra Pandey, who is also a member of the three-member committee formed to recommend nominations, asked party President Sushil Koirala to rectify the nominations. In a letter to Koirala, Pandey said party General Secretary Prakash Man Singh and central committee member Bal Bahadur KC, two other members in the committee, made the nominations despite his objection on the names picked as central members of the student wing.



He said the nomination of 101members is against the agreement between Koirala and Sher Bahadur Deuba. They, according to Pandey, had agreed to form a 51-member Nepal Students´ Union.



Meanwhile, members nominated in the student wing from the Deuba faction have threatened to resign in protest of the nominations.
